4K NINJAS TAKE COLOR MONITORING 'ON THE ROAD' WITH JMR'S BLUESTOR DIGILAB AT CINE GEAR EXPO 2010



Live demonstration will illustrate how DigiLab Video Server saves valuable production time and money

JMR Electronics Inc., the leading performance provider of scalable storage systems for video and data intensive applications, will showcase its just released BlueStor™ DigiLab™ Video Server at Cine Gear Expo 2010 on June 4th and 5th.

With the help of a group of RED ONE™ 4K camera users known as the 4K Ninjas, DigiLab will be demonstrated in a rack arrangement on board the team's "Road Grader," a Dodge Sprinter van that serves as a mobile data processing center. The 4K Ninjas' DigiLab setup will feature Assimilate™ SCRATCH® software, an NVIDIA® Quadro® Plex multi-GPU visual computing system (VCS) and RED ROCKET™ graphics acceleration hardware.

BlueStor DigiLab is an extremely flexible, open platform storage system that delivers unprecedented on-location digital image processing performance, high resolution monitoring and control functionality for the most demanding digital cinema workflows.  The DigiLab provides the ability to quickly capture files directly from the camera's storage, monitor raw footage in real time, apply first pass color correction right on location and even burn a Blu-ray™ disc for dailies with the viewing LUTs (Look Up Tables) applied.

At Cine Gear Expo, the DigiLab will run Assimilate's SCRATCH software with 4K RED footage output to a 4K display, thus showcasing the server's strengths as a mobile, on-set color monitoring and color grading platform. Earlier this year, DigiLab proved its worth in the field during the production of Sixteen Wishes, a film scheduled to air this summer on the Disney Channel. DigiLab's unique ability to ingest, review and process HD footage, saved the production thousands of dollars in daily lab fees. DigiLab's installation on board the Road Grader will mark its first use in a studio on wheels. Its 3x3 foot size makes it an extremely portable asset to any HD video or feature film production.
